Matt has been invited to participate in a panel discussion at the annual Society of Biblical Literature (SBL) Annual Meeting in Atlanta, Georgia, which runs 20-23 November 2010. He will join leading Christian academics Paul Copan, Richard Hess and Randal Rauser in a segment entitled “Navigating Old Testament Ethics.” Matt’s contribution to the panel discussion will be on Divine Commands and Old Testament Ethics.
The SBL Annual Meeting is the largest gathering of biblical scholars in the world. Each meeting:
- showcases the latest in biblical research,
- fosters collegial contacts,
- advances research, and
- focuses on issues of the profession.
At this meeting, scholars benefit from sessions on religion, philosophy, ethics, and diverse religious traditions.
